What is the are around Acton Town station like? by [deleted] in london

[–]Adept_Zebra9560 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Be careful around the surrounding parks at night, there’s a lot of muggings that happen there. Also be wary on Acton high street, you can see where it gets sketchy past the big Morrisons. The area around Acton Town station is relatively quiet but it’s run down and you have a lot of school kids during rush hours. There’s not much to do other than go somewhere else, but the transport links are amazing.

For things nearby I’d recommend going around Ealing Common or West Acton if you’re a fan of Japanese stuff they have some supermarkets, restaurants and a hair salon between those areas. By Ealing Common station there’s some small shops I’d recommend like the Turkish market, they have fresh bread and pastries every morning. In Ealing there’s also Ealing Broadway (shopping centre) so that’ll keep you busy if you need something.
